  • This was his first GP win. It was in Portugal at the Estoril track. He almost won 1 year earlier in Monaco but the race was interrupted when he was about to pass Alan Prost with a crappy car. "Too much rain" they said when the race was interrupted. There wasn't too much rain for Ayrton Senna.
